A Self-jump capable Geosurvey Vessel designed in 2036.
Background
The Lyell faced a drawn out approval process first with three options presented to the UNEC, the Lyell-B was chosen, then a tendering process saw Cornucopia picked to build the Lyell but the specifics on the price and other technological trade offers became rather convoluted, dragging on for months, in the mean time, the original design spec was lost and a new one had to be drafted on the theoretical performance draft. Finally the UNRL Deputy was dissatisfied with the approval process and expedited vote raised by UNIN to conclude the deal with Cornucopia moved the vote was illegitimate, finally the UNRL Councillor opted to vote with UNIN and the deal was struck.
10 Lyells were ordered from Cornucopia for 14.25Bn Euros + Ion Engine technology and 120t of Neutronium to assist Cornucopian shipyards in building a second slipway.
